• Compiler Support for Parallel Evaluation of C++ Constant Expressions 

      Gozillon, Andrew; Haeri, Seyed Hossein; Riordan, James; Keir, Paul (Journal article; Peer reviewed, 2023)
      Metaprogramming, the practice of writing programs that manipulate other programs at compile-time, continues to impact software development; enabling new approaches to optimisation, static analysis, and reflection. Nevertheless, ...